    Yeah man no problem.

    1. I would either change the logo or get rid of it entirely. You could change it to the initials of your name or something that involves your services? Though web design and programming might be a hard one in that aspect.

    2. The text i personally think needs to change to a less cartoonish looking set. Then again a portfolio site should reflect you as a person and your services. Just if your going to be using this site as a professional outlet for getting business, and so fourth, maybe go towards a text type that makes the statement, but doesn't keep the traffics eye focused more on it then the content.

    3. Look around the web, get some inspiration from what other sites are doing, in your case look at some professional portfolio sites to see what you find appealing and use them as an inspiration.
